Publications
 

Publications are central to FAO's work as a knowledge organization. More than 300 titles per year are published -- usually in multiple language versions -- on topics such as hunger and food security, commodity markets, climate change, nutrition, fisheries, forests, rural livelihoods and much more.

  

FAO's flagship publications

FAO’s most important publications present comprehensive and objective information and analysis on the current global state of food and agriculture, fisheries and aquaculture, forests, agricultural commodity markets and hunger. These titles are issued regularly, to inform public debate and policy-making at national and international levels.

• The State of Food and Agriculture (SOFA)
• The State of World Fisheries and Aquaculture (SOFIA)
• State of the World's Forests (SOFO)
• The State of Food Insecurity in the World (SOFI)
• The State of Agricultural Commodity Markets (SOCO)
